Definition of magnetic separation. i. The separation of magnetic materials from nonmagnetic materials, using a magnet. This is an esp. important process in the beneficiation of iron ores in which the magnetic mineral is separated from nonmagnetic material; e.g., magnetite from other minerals, roasted pyrite from sphalerite, etc.

Magnetic separation is the process of separating components of mixtures by using magnets to attract magnetic materials. The process that is used for magnetic separation detaches non-magnetic material with those that are magnetic.
The use of strong magnetic field gradients and high magnetic fields generated by permanent magnets or superconducting coils has found applications in many fields such as mining, solid state chemistry, biochemistry and medical research.
